Back to Blog

How to Add Intercom to WordPress: Step-by-Step Guide

AI for Internal Operations > IT & Technical Support16 min read

How to Add Intercom to WordPress: Step-by-Step Guide

Key Facts

  • 79% of consumers prefer live chat for quick customer service questions (Forrester)
  • 63% of customers will abandon a purchase after a poor support experience (Microsoft)
  • Only 25% of WordPress sites currently offer live chat, leaving 3 in 4 behind (BuiltWith, 2024)
  • WooCommerce + Intercom integration takes under 15 minutes—no coding required (WooCommerce Docs)
  • 89% of customers switch to competitors after a single bad support interaction (Accenture)
  • AI chatbots with poor escalation lose trust—Jagex’s bot drew 976 upvotes on a Reddit critique
  • Businesses using Intercom see 40% faster resolution times with automated workflows (Tidio Blog, 2024)

Why Your WordPress Site Needs Intercom Integration

Why Your WordPress Site Needs Intercom Integration

Customers today expect instant, personalized support—and slow responses damage trust. With 79% of consumers preferring live chat for quick questions (Forrester), WordPress sites without real-time engagement risk losing visitors and sales.

For WooCommerce stores, support isn’t just about answering queries—it’s about resolving issues fast using real customer data. Yet most WordPress sites rely on static contact forms or email, leading to delays and frustration.

  • 63% of customers say they’ll abandon a purchase after poor service (Microsoft)
  • 89% will switch to a competitor following a bad support experience (Accenture)
  • Only 25% of WordPress sites offer live chat (BuiltWith, 2024)

The gap is clear: basic support tools no longer suffice. Users demand context-aware, immediate help—and Intercom closes that gap.

Take Jagex, makers of RuneScape. Their AI chatbot rollout drew 976 upvotes on Reddit in a single critique thread. Why? Because the bot failed to escalate issues, forcing users into frustrating loops. The lesson? AI must assist—not replace—human support.

Intercom solves this with smart messaging, automated workflows, and seamless human handoffs. When integrated with WordPress—especially WooCommerce—it unlocks real-time support powered by actual user behavior and order history.

Unlike basic chat plugins, Intercom doesn’t just answer questions. It tracks user actions, triggers proactive messages, and routes complex cases to the right agent—cutting response times and boosting satisfaction.

Consider a WooCommerce store noticing cart abandonment. With Intercom, the site can instantly message: “Need help checking out? We’re here.”—personalized with the user’s name and cart contents.

This level of context-aware engagement isn’t possible with standard forms or email. But it is with Intercom.

And setup? Thanks to the official WooCommerce Intercom plugin, it takes under 15 minutes—no coding required.

The bottom line: If your WordPress site handles customer interactions, real-time, intelligent support isn’t optional—it’s essential. The next section walks you through exactly how to make it happen.

The Core Challenge: Fragmented Support on WordPress

Running a WordPress site without a unified messaging layer is like managing a busy store with no intercom—chaotic, slow, and frustrating for both customers and support teams.

Most WordPress sites rely on disjointed tools: contact forms, email tickets, live chat plugins, and social media DMs. This fragmentation leads to delayed responses, lost context, and repetitive customer queries.

  • Customer inquiries scatter across email, forms, and social platforms
  • Support agents waste time switching between tools and searching for data
  • No real-time engagement means missed opportunities to resolve issues early

Without centralized communication, technical support becomes reactive instead of proactive. A 2023 Tidio blog report found that 4.8 out of 5 users expect instant replies, yet most WordPress sites fail to meet this standard due to tool overload.

Consider Jagex, the gaming company behind RuneScape. Their AI chatbot rollout was met with a Reddit backlash (976 upvotes on a critique post), where users complained about bots that couldn’t handle account or billing issues. The core problem? No seamless path to human agents.

Similarly, businesses using WooCommerce lose critical context—like order history or cart behavior—when support exists outside the customer journey. But it doesn’t have to be this way.

The WooCommerce Intercom Integration plugin solves this by syncing customer data directly—name, email, purchase history, and spend—into Intercom’s messaging platform. Setup takes under 15 minutes using secure OAuth 2.0 authentication, according to official WooCommerce documentation.

This integration brings context-aware support to the forefront. Agents see the full customer journey before responding, slashing resolution time and improving accuracy.

Real-time messaging, behavior-triggered automations, and unified conversation history transform how support teams operate—especially when technical and customer service workflows converge.

Yet, the official Intercom integration only works natively with WooCommerce-powered WordPress sites. For others, solutions like Zapier, webhooks, or AI chatbot plugins (e.g., Tidio, WPBot) offer partial workarounds, but lack deep e-commerce alignment.

The key takeaway? Fragmentation isn’t just inefficient—it damages trust. Users demand seamless, intelligent support that knows who they are and what they need.

Next, we’ll explore how Intercom bridges this gap—with step-by-step integration that turns isolated interactions into unified, intelligent conversations.

The Solution: Integrating Intercom with WordPress

The Solution: Integrating Intercom with WordPress

Unlock powerful customer support by connecting Intercom directly to your WordPress site—especially if you run WooCommerce. This integration transforms how you engage users, offering real-time chat, automated workflows, and rich customer insights—all without heavy coding.

The official WooCommerce Intercom plugin is the most reliable path for e-commerce sites. Built by WooCommerce and hosted in the WordPress plugin directory, it uses OAuth 2.0 authentication for secure, seamless connectivity.

  • Setup typically takes under 15 minutes
  • No developer required
  • Syncs key customer data: name, email, order history, total spend
  • Enables behavior-triggered messaging (e.g., cart abandonment)
  • Fully supported by WooCommerce documentation

Once live, support teams gain context-aware conversations—meaning agents see purchase history and user behavior before responding. This reduces back-and-forth and speeds up resolution times.

For example, a customer messages, “Where’s my order?” With Intercom + WooCommerce, the agent instantly sees the order status, shipping details, and past interactions—no need to ask for email or order number.

According to WooCommerce’s official documentation, the plugin securely syncs real-time data using OAuth 2.0, ensuring privacy and accuracy.

But what if you don’t use WooCommerce?

Non-e-commerce WordPress sites can still leverage Intercom—just not through a native plugin. Instead, use:

  • Zapier integrations to connect form submissions (e.g., Contact Form 7) to Intercom
  • Custom webhooks for login events or content engagement tracking
  • Manual script insertion of Intercom’s JavaScript snippet into WordPress headers

These methods allow targeted messaging based on user actions, even without purchase data.

While tools like Tidio and WPBot offer easier AI chatbot setups with built-in WordPress plugins, they lack the deep CRM and automation capabilities of Intercom. However, they can complement Intercom by handling basic FAQs and routing complex issues.

A Reddit thread on r/2007scape received 976 upvotes criticizing Jagex’s AI support bot for failing to resolve account issues—highlighting the risk of fully automated, poorly designed systems.

This reinforces a key insight: AI should assist, not replace, human support. Intercom excels here with its hybrid inbox model, where bots and humans collaborate seamlessly.

Next, we’ll walk through the exact steps to install and configure Intercom—whether you’re using WooCommerce or a standard WordPress site.

Best Practices for Smarter Support with Intercom

Transform your WordPress support with intelligent automation and seamless human escalation.
Integrating Intercom isn’t just about adding a chat widget—it’s about building a smarter, faster, and more responsive support engine. When done right, it reduces resolution times, boosts satisfaction, and frees up agents for high-impact work.

The key? AI-augmented workflows, clear escalation paths, and deep data integration—especially for WooCommerce stores syncing order history and behavior.

  • Use behavior-triggered messages to proactively assist users (e.g., cart abandonment)
  • Automate common queries (order status, returns) with bots
  • Sync customer data (spend, purchase history) for context-rich support
  • Enable sentiment-aware handoffs to human agents
  • Continuously optimize using CSAT and resolution time metrics

According to WooCommerce, the official Intercom plugin enables secure OAuth 2.0 setup in under 15 minutes, syncing critical customer data like name, email, and order history directly into Intercom. This allows support teams to see full context at a glance—no more asking, “What did you order?”

Tidio’s blog reports its WordPress chatbot plugin holds a 4.8/5 rating from 390+ reviews, reflecting strong user satisfaction with AI-powered support when implemented well. But beware: Reddit’s r/2007scape community delivered a stark warning—976 upvotes on a post titled “Jagex, this support chatbot is unacceptable”—highlighting user frustration when bots fail to escalate.

Example: A WooCommerce store used Intercom + a simple AI bot to handle 40% of inbound queries automatically. When a user typed “refund,” the bot pulled order details, confirmed eligibility, and either processed it or escalated with full context. Result: first response time dropped by 60%.

For non-WooCommerce sites, leverage Zapier or webhooks to sync form submissions or login events into Intercom, enabling targeted messaging even without e-commerce data.

The goal isn’t full automation—it’s intelligent triage.
Next, we’ll walk through the exact steps to integrate Intercom with your WordPress site, whether you're running WooCommerce or a standard blog.

Implementation: Step-by-Step Setup Guide

Implementation: Step-by-Step Setup Guide

Get Intercom up and running on your WordPress site in minutes—with zero coding. The official WooCommerce plugin makes integration fast, secure, and seamless for e-commerce stores.

Follow this clear, sequential guide to enable real-time messaging, sync customer data, and enhance technical support efficiency.


If your WordPress site runs WooCommerce, use the official Intercom Integration plugin—developed and maintained by WooCommerce for secure, reliable performance.

  • Log into your WordPress admin dashboard
  • Navigate to Plugins > Add New
  • Search for “Intercom Integration for WooCommerce”
  • Click Install Now, then Activate

This free plugin uses OAuth 2.0 authentication, eliminating the need to manually handle API keys and reducing security risks.

Once activated, you’ll be redirected to Intercom to complete authorization—ensuring a safe, user-friendly setup process.

Source: WooCommerce Documentation – High Credibility


After activation, link your WordPress site to your Intercom workspace.

  • Click Connect to Intercom in the plugin settings
  • Log into your Intercom account or create one if needed
  • Grant the requested permissions (e.g., read customer data, send messages)

The connection syncs key WooCommerce data automatically, including: - Customer name and email
- Order history and total spend
- Products purchased and purchase frequency

This enables context-aware support, allowing agents to see user behavior before responding.

Source: WooCommerce Docs – Synced Data Confirmed


Tailor the Intercom Messenger to match your brand and support goals.

  • Go to Intercom Dashboard > Messenger > Settings
  • Upload your logo and set brand colors
  • Write a proactive greeting message (e.g., “Need help with your order?”)
  • Set availability hours and assign team members

Use behavior-triggered messages to engage users: - Abandoned cart reminders
- Post-purchase onboarding tips
- Re-engagement prompts after inactivity

These automated nudges improve customer experience and reduce support volume.

Example: A Shopify-WooCommerce hybrid store reduced ticket volume by 32% using targeted in-app messages after purchase.


Leverage Intercom’s automation to streamline support and boost efficiency.

Create workflows based on: - User actions (e.g., completed purchase, visited pricing page)
- Customer tags or segments (e.g., high-LTV, first-time buyer)
- Inactivity thresholds (e.g., cart abandoned for 2 hours)

Use cases include: - Sending order confirmation follow-ups
- Triggering technical troubleshooting guides
- Escalating high-priority issues to human agents

Automations reduce first response time—a key KPI linked to customer satisfaction.

Stat: Businesses using automation report 40% faster resolution times (Tidio Blog, 2024)


For non-e-commerce WordPress sites, direct Intercom integration isn’t available—but Zapier or webhooks bridge the gap.

Use these tools to: - Sync form submissions (via WPForms or Contact Form 7) to Intercom
- Trigger messages when users log in or visit key pages
- Forward chatbot conversations to Intercom inbox

Alternatively, deploy AI chatbots like WPBot or Tidio with built-in Intercom sync.

WPBot Pro supports Zapier, webhooks, and CRM integrations—ideal for AI-powered triage before escalating to Intercom.

Source: WordPress Plugin Directory – WPBot Pro Features


Now that Intercom is live, the next step is optimizing support performance—starting with training your AI agents.

Frequently Asked Questions

Is Intercom worth it for small WordPress businesses?
Yes—especially if you use WooCommerce. Intercom reduces response times by up to 60% and can cut support ticket volume by over 30% using automated, behavior-triggered messages. For small teams, this means faster customer service without hiring more staff.
Can I add Intercom to WordPress without using WooCommerce?
Yes, but not natively. Use Zapier or webhooks to connect form submissions or user actions (like logins) to Intercom. Alternatively, embed Intercom’s JavaScript snippet manually in your theme or via a plugin like Insert Headers and Footers.
Does Intercom slow down my WordPress site?
No—Intercom loads asynchronously, so it doesn’t block page rendering. The official WooCommerce plugin is optimized for performance and typically adds less than 50KB of data. Sites using it report no measurable impact on load speed.
Will Intercom replace my support team?
No—and it shouldn’t. Intercom automates routine queries (like order status), but its strength is seamless human handoffs. For example, 40% of queries can be handled by bots, freeing agents to focus on complex issues that need personal attention.
How do I make sure customers aren’t stuck in an AI loop with Intercom?
Set clear escalation rules: allow users to request a human agent, and use sentiment triggers to detect frustration. For instance, if someone types 'speak to a person,' route them immediately to a live agent with full conversation history.
Can I customize the Intercom chat widget to match my brand?
Yes—upload your logo, set brand colors, and write custom greeting messages directly in the Intercom dashboard. For WooCommerce stores, you can even personalize messages based on customer behavior, like showing a cart recovery prompt after abandonment.

Turn Visitors into Loyal Customers with Smarter WordPress Support

Integrating Intercom with WordPress isn’t just a tech upgrade—it’s a transformation in how you engage, support, and retain customers. As we’ve seen, traditional contact forms and delayed email responses can't keep up with modern expectations for instant, personalized service. With Intercom, your WooCommerce store gains the power to deliver real-time support enriched by user behavior, purchase history, and intelligent automation. This means faster resolutions, fewer abandoned carts, and stronger customer loyalty. But more than that, it aligns with our core business value: empowering teams to deliver exceptional, human-centered support—augmented by AI, not replaced by it. The Jagex example reminds us that users demand empathy and escalation paths, not just scripted bots. Intercom delivers both, seamlessly. Now is the time to bridge the support gap. If you're ready to boost customer satisfaction, reduce response times, and turn casual visitors into repeat buyers, start your Intercom integration today. Visit our support portal for a step-by-step implementation guide and unlock the full potential of intelligent, data-driven customer engagement on your WordPress site.

Get AI Insights Delivered

Subscribe to our newsletter for the latest AI trends, tutorials, and AgentiveAI updates.

READY TO BUILD YOURAI-POWERED FUTURE?

Join thousands of businesses using AgentiveAI to transform customer interactions and drive growth with intelligent AI agents.

No credit card required • 14-day free trial • Cancel anytime